How to replace a battery

All car key fobs which enable and lock your vehicle remotely have a battery that will eventually fail. If that happens, owners can replace the key fob battery themselves in a couple of simple steps. The key fob comes with two plastic flaps on the one side that must be lift to remove the old battery and install the new one. The CR1632 battery that is standard in size can be used to replace. It is easy to install.

After removing the emergency key, you can use the flathead screwdriver with small pieces of wood to split the case. Do not force the case too hard as the electronics are delicate and may be damaged by excessive pressure.

How to Resolve the Case

If you're replacing the battery or the manual key it's a good idea to replace the case too. The cases tend to wear out quickly, especially when they are used for a long time. It's easy to change the case of your saab keys replacement 9-3 and you won't require any special tools.

To replace the case, you first need to remove the manual key from your key fob. This can be accomplished by pressing the saab replacement key programming logo and then pulling out the manual key. The fob for the key may be sticky at times, and it may require a bit of force to take the key out.

After you've removed the manual key from the case, you can begin to remove the electronic components. You'll require a flathead screwdriver to do this. You'll want to be careful not to damage the electronics inside, so be careful when using your screwdriver. Once you've removed all electronics, you can start working on removing the battery. After you've replaced your battery, it's time to put everything back together in a new case. You can purchase cases for replacement on the internet for a very low cost.
